summaryrefslogtreecommitdiffstats
path: root/src/corelib/tools/qstring.h
Commit message (Expand)AuthorAgeFilesLines
* Move text-related code out of corelib/tools/ to corelib/text/Edward Welbourne2019-07-101-2043/+0
* Be less laissez-faire with implicit conversions to QCharMarc Mutz2019-07-091-5/+5
* QCharRef/QByteRef: schedule for Qt 7 removalGiuseppe D'Angelo2019-07-011-1/+1
* QString: fix comments for qsizetypeAnton Kudryavtsev2019-06-271-10/+10
* QString: towards QStringView::arg() pt.4: port QString::arg() to QStringView:...Marc Mutz2019-06-041-9/+9
* QString: towards QStringView::arg() pt.3: Long live QStringView/QLatin1String...Marc Mutz2019-06-201-0/+55
* QStringView, QLatin1String: add lastIndexOf methodsAnton Kudryavtsev2019-06-181-2/+20
* Deprecate QLatin1LiteralGiuseppe D'Angelo2019-06-101-1/+3
* QLatin1String, QStringView: add containsAnton Kudryavtsev2019-06-041-3/+26
* QString/QByteArray: detach immediately in operator[]Giuseppe D'Angelo2019-05-191-6/+10
* Long live Qt::SplitBehavior!Marc Mutz2019-05-211-0/+29
* QCharRef/QByteRef: warn when triggering the resizing operator= behaviorGiuseppe D'Angelo2019-05-191-3/+22
* Qt 6: unexport QCharRef / QByteRefGiuseppe D'Angelo2019-05-181-2/+5
* Merge remote-tracking branch 'origin/5.13' into devLiang Qi2019-05-131-1/+1
|\
| * Doc: replace even more null/0/nullptr with \nullptr macroChristian Ehrlicher2019-05-081-1/+1
* | QStringView, QLatin1String: add indexOf methodsAnton Kudryavtsev2019-05-101-2/+20
* | Remove handling of missing Q_COMPILER_RVALUE_REFSAllan Sandfeld Jensen2019-05-011-4/+0
* | Replace Q_DECL_NOEXCEPT with noexcept in corelibAllan Sandfeld Jensen2019-04-031-211/+211
* | Add QStringView::toWCharArray() to match QStringEdward Welbourne2019-03-081-6/+1
* | Simplify toStdWStringGiuseppe D'Angelo2019-03-051-7/+5
* | QString: mark obsolete functions as deprecatedChristian Ehrlicher2019-03-041-0/+4
|/
* Merge remote-tracking branch 'origin/5.12' into devQt Forward Merge Bot2018-09-061-1/+8
|\
| * Add QString::compare(QStringView, CaseSensitivity)Albert Astals Cid2018-09-031-1/+8
* | Remove QConditional in favor of std::conditional/std::is_unsignedMikhail Svetkin2018-09-051-4/+2
|/
* Remove unused QString::toLatin1_helper overloadThiago Macieira2018-06-161-1/+0
* Merge remote-tracking branch 'origin/5.11' into devQt Forward Merge Bot2018-03-211-4/+10
|\
| * Modernize the "regularexpression" featureUlf Hermann2018-03-201-4/+4
| * q{,Utf8}Printable: avoid creating a copy of a QStringThiago Macieira2018-03-181-0/+6
* | QString: Add functions isUpper and isLowerAndre Hartmann2018-02-111-0/+3
|/
* QString:: add remove() overload taking QLatin1StringAnton Kudryavtsev2018-02-021-0/+1
* Add a few methods to check if a string is US-ASCII or Latin1Thiago Macieira2018-01-271-0/+6
* QtCore: Raise minimum supported MSVC version to 2015Friedemann Kleint2018-01-081-1/+1
* Disable some implicit conversions with QT_RESTRICTED_CAST_FROM_ASCIIAlexander Volkov2017-12-011-0/+4
* Merge remote-tracking branch 'origin/5.10' into devLiang Qi2017-11-051-28/+28
|\
| * Mark the previously public qstringalgorithms.h functions privateThiago Macieira2017-10-291-28/+28
* | Merge remote-tracking branch 'origin/5.10' into devLiang Qi2017-10-171-10/+10
|\ \ | |/
| * Remove Q_ALWAYS_INLINE from frequently-used functionsThiago Macieira2017-09-291-10/+10
* | Replace Q_NULLPTR with nullptr where possibleKevin Funk2017-09-191-24/+24
|/
* Merge remote-tracking branch 'origin/5.9' into devLiang Qi2017-08-311-1/+1
|\
| * Android: Dissable internal hack when using libc++BogDan Vatra2017-08-181-1/+1
* | Merge "Merge remote-tracking branch 'origin/5.9' into dev" into refs/staging/devLiang Qi2017-06-201-1/+1
|\ \
| * \ Merge remote-tracking branch 'origin/5.9' into devLiang Qi2017-06-191-1/+1
| |\ \ | | |/
| | * Use the C++ [[nodiscard]] attributeThiago Macieira2017-06-071-1/+1
* | | Move Q_REQUIRED_RESULT to its correct positionThiago Macieira2017-06-201-5/+5
|/ /
* | QStringView/QLatin1String: add trimmed()Marc Mutz2017-05-161-0/+2
* | QLatin1String: add constructor from pointer pairMarc Mutz2017-05-161-0/+2
* | QLatin1String: add startsWith()/endsWith()Marc Mutz2017-04-281-0/+18
* | QStringView: add startsWith(), endsWith()Marc Mutz2017-04-281-0/+8
* | QString/Ref: add startsWith/endsWith(QStringView) overloadsMarc Mutz2017-04-281-2/+19
* | Disentangle string-related headersMarc Mutz2017-04-251-88/+12